Every Good and Perfect Gift
My friend Kevin has a story that still humbles me every time I hear it.
When a tumor ruptured his stomach,
he almost bled to death in his own bed.
By every measure, he shouldn’t be here.
But he is.
Some would say it was the chemo.
The surgeons.
The timing.
The medicine.
Some might even say luck.
But Kevin says it was God.
And he’s right.
Because God created all of it.
The science.
The skill.
The wisdom.
The very elements that make healing possible.
God set it all in motion.
We like to categorize things.
Miracle or medicine.
Supernatural or scientific.
But God does not divide.
He designed.
James wrote, “Every good and perfect gift is from above.”
Every single one.
The chemo that worked.
The doctor who stayed late.
The nurse who whispered a prayer.
The peace that came in the night.
All of it was God’s doing.
So yes, Kevin can say,
God healed me.
Because He did.
He used medicine,
but the mercy was His.
He used doctors,
but the power was His.
Every good and perfect gift
still flows from Heaven.
So the next time someone tries to stop your thanksgiving,
just remember who made the cure, who gave the breath,
and the One who wrote your story.
